| AmREIT, Inc. (AmREIT) is a full-service, vertically integrated and self-administered real estate investment trust (REIT), which owns, operates, acquires and selectively develops and redevelops neighborhood and community shopping centers, which it refers to as Irreplaceable Corners. The Company’s shopping centers are anchored by retailers, including supermarket chains, drug stores and other necessity-based retailers. Its remaining tenants consist of specialty retailers and national and local restaurants. Its portfolio is concentrated in the submarkets of Houston, Dallas, San Antonio, Austin and Atlanta. Its segments include portfolio, real estate operating and development business and its advised funds. On February 25, 2011, the Company acquired The Market at Lake Houston. On May 10, 2011, the Company acquired Brookwood Village. On July 6, 2011, the Company sold two non-core, single-tenant assets to a third party. On July 29, 2011, the Company acquired Alpharetta Commons. |
